ECS Limited is offering a unique opportunity for an experienced Construction Materials Testing (CMT) Principal Engineer to join our Baton Rouge, LA field services team in a dynamic work environment. The Construction Materials Testing (CMT) Principal serves as the highest level of technical leadership within the CMT practice, responsible for ensuring overall quality, performance, and strategic direction of projects and services. This role provides final technical authority, oversees execution across projects and departments, and drives business development and client relationships at a high level. The CMT Principal operates as a subject matter expert, mentor, and leader within the organization while maintaining a positive customer service attitude and demonstrating ECS Core Values.

ECS Group of Companies (ECS) was founded in 1988 with the goal to raise the standards of professional engineering consulting. Today, we are a leader in geotechnical, construction materials, environmental and facilities consulting services. We are employee-owned with more than 3,000 employees in 100+ offices and testing facilities coast to coast. ECS is currently ranked #60 in Engineering News-Record’s Top 500 Design Firms (April 2026), #148 in Engineering News-Record’s Top 200 Environmental Firms (October 2025) and #50 in Zweig Group’s Hot Firm List (May 2025).
